What Are the Best Superfeet Insoles for Basketball?
The best Superfeet insoles for basketball are designed to enhance performance, provide support, and improve comfort during play.
- Superfeet Green: This model is known for its high arch support and deep heel cup, providing stability and shock absorption. The premium materials used in its construction help reduce fatigue, making it ideal for the rigorous demands of basketball.
- Superfeet Blue: The Blue insoles offer a medium arch support and a more flexible design, catering to players who need a balance of cushioning and control. Its lightweight structure makes it a good choice for those who prefer a less restrictive feel while playing.
- Superfeet Carbon: Designed for low-profile footwear, the Carbon insoles provide excellent energy transfer and responsiveness. They feature a thinner design but still maintain essential support, making them suitable for basketball shoes with a snug fit.
- Superfeet Orange: This model focuses on maximum cushioning and comfort, with a thicker foam layer to absorb impact effectively. It’s ideal for players who prioritize comfort over arch support and need extra padding during long sessions on the court.
- Superfeet High-Performance RUN: While primarily aimed at runners, these insoles are versatile enough for basketball players seeking enhanced support and shock absorption. They feature a specialized design that accommodates various foot shapes, ensuring a snug fit in most basketball shoes.

What Should Basketball Players Look for When Choosing Superfeet Insoles?
When choosing the best Superfeet insoles for basketball, players should consider several key factors to enhance performance and comfort.
- Arch Support: The right level of arch support is crucial as it helps to stabilize the foot during quick movements and jumps. Players with high arches may need insoles that provide more support, while those with flat feet might benefit from insoles designed to alleviate pressure on the arches.
- Cushioning: Adequate cushioning absorbs impact during play, reducing stress on joints and minimizing fatigue. Superfeet insoles often use varying foam densities that cater to different preferences for softness or firmness, allowing players to choose based on their individual needs.
- Fit and Sizing: A proper fit is essential for insoles to function effectively, as poorly fitted insoles can lead to blisters or discomfort. Players should select insoles that match their shoe size and follow Superfeet’s fitting guidelines to ensure optimal performance.
- Durability: Given the intense nature of basketball, insoles should be durable enough to withstand frequent use. Superfeet insoles are designed with robust materials that provide longevity, ensuring players can rely on them for multiple seasons without significant wear.
- Moisture Management: Basketball players often sweat during games, so insoles with moisture-wicking properties can help keep feet dry and reduce odor. This feature enhances comfort and hygiene, allowing players to focus on their performance without distraction.
- Stability Features: Some Superfeet insoles include additional stability features that help prevent excessive foot movement inside the shoe. This is important for basketball players who need to make quick lateral movements and cuts, as it can contribute to better overall control on the court.

How Can You Care for Your Superfeet Insoles to Maximize Their Lifespan?
To maximize the lifespan of your Superfeet insoles, proper care is essential. Follow these tips to keep your insoles in optimal condition:
-
Regular Cleaning: Remove the insoles from your shoes and clean them with a damp cloth and mild soap. Avoid washing machines or dryers, as they can damage the materials.
-
Drying Properly: After cleaning, air dry your insoles in a well-ventilated area, away from direct heat sources. This prevents warping and material breakdown.
-
Rotate Your Insoles: If you have multiple pairs of shoes, consider rotating your insoles. This allows them to recover their shape and cushioning between uses.
-
Storage: Store your insoles in a cool, dry place when not in use. Avoid folding or compressing them, as this can affect their structure.
-
Avoid Excessive Moisture: Use moisture-wicking socks and consider foot powders to control sweat. Excess moisture can lead to odor and material degradation.
-
Inspect Regularly: Check for wear and tear regularly. Replace the insoles when you notice significant signs of wear to maintain foot support and comfort.
By following these care tips, your Superfeet insoles can continue to provide the support and comfort needed for basketball and other activities for an extended period.
